Broken Keys

When your car key breaks inside the lock, it could be a major hassle. Luckily, there are some ways you can try to retrieve your car key that has broken prior to making a call to a locksmith for assistance.

Spray lubricant into the keyhole to reduce friction. This will make it easier to get rid of broken pieces. You can also use a thin wire to hold the protruding piece so that you can pull it. Also needle nose pliers can be used to extract broken keys. When using these tools, it is crucial to exercise caution so as not to push the broken piece of key further into the lock.

Superglue is a different trick that is widely used. It is used to glue the key's end to stick out of the lock. This is not the best solution for the average user as it can be messy and ineffective. The glue could get in every nook and cranny of the lock, making it even difficult to pull the broken piece out.

In most cases you will need to contact an locksmith to replace a broken key. It is important to keep both keys however, as they can help the locksmith understand how to make a replacement. It's also cheaper to have a locksmith create you a new key without the original one, especially when it's an older car that doesn't need a chip.

Door Locks

Occasionally, your door locks can get a little sticky. This can be due to a variety of reasons, including weather changes and changes in the dimensions of the door frame. When this occurs the lock tumblers on the key get clogged by debris and may not turn properly. A little lubrication can help in this case. Then, you can insert the key into the keyhole of the lock after coating it with graphite powder or spray. The graphite will provide lubrication and allow the tumblers to turn properly. This simple, quick fix often enough to fix the problem.

In certain cases the issue may be due to an issue with the alignment of the lock cylinder. To correct this issue, first loosen the screws that secure the cylinder, but don't remove them entirely. With a screwdriver and a small adjustment, align the keyhole of the door to the keyway of the cylinder. After repositioning, tighten all screws.

If your lock's cylinder sticks or does not respond to lubrication, you might have to replace it. It's not as difficult as it sounds. You'll need to buy a rekey kit that matches your lock. The rekeying kits will usually include a variety of tools as well as pins of different sizes that you will need to remove from your cylinder. The pins will be replaced by new ones of the same length in order to re-align your lock's keyway.
